Reliance MediaWorks eyes south India expansion

Reliance MediaWorks, the entertainment division of Anil Ambani's empire, is to expand its domestic operations in the field of broadcasting, television commercials and film – particularly in South India.

"In 2012, we plan to deepen our presence in Tamil and Telugu markets through strategic alliances, further strengthen our offerings and leverage of existing relationships with capacity expansion and new strategic partnerships," said Anil Arjun, chief executive.

The company has recently partnered VenSat to grow its animation output and create a studio in Chennai. It will also manage and operate the Annapurna Studios facilities and expand the company's post-production centre at the Hydrabad studios.

Reliance MediaWorks' television venture, BIG Synergy, is a major player in TV programming, while its post production services are pervasive across India.

In 2011, the company claims its post production services, including processing, digital cinema mastering, and promos, trailers and visual effects, were applied to 110 out of the 114 Bollywood films released in 2011.

In addition, it offers digital imaging, visual effects and digital restoration services.
